Highly pathogenic avian influenza H5N1 in U.S. dairy cattle

A study published in Nature provides evidence of mammal-to-mammal transmission of the virus, between cows and from cows to cats and a raccoon, highlighting the ability of the virus to cross species barriers. The researchers say that the spillover of HPAI H5N1 into dairy cattle and evidence for efficient and sustained mammal-to-mammal transmission are unprecedented.…
